Isaac Hopkins & Company :I Hopkins & Co.'s circular and illustrated price list of beeke...
Date: 1897
By: Isaac Hopkins & Company
Reference: Eph-A-BEE-SUPPLIES-1897-01
Description: Lists and illustrates items for sale, with prices. Merchandise includes: extractors, honey tanks, hives, section boxes, smokers, knives, rubber gloves, dry-sugar feeders, comb holders, hive clamps, wax extractors, comb holders, Apifuge (insect repellant), honey tins and labels, Italian queen bees, fruit cases. Quantity: 1 album(s). Physical Description: Letterpress, in booklet of 16 pages, each 215 x 140 mm.

Alliance Box Company Ltd :Alliance beekeepers supplies, season 1914-15. William Rowe, a...
Date: 1914
By: Alliance Box Company Ltd; Stone, Son and Company
Reference: Eph-A-BEE-SUPPLIES-1914-01
Description: Lists and illustrates items for sale, with prices. Merchandise includes: "Alliance" dove-tailed hive, smokers, sections, division board feeders, Root's capping melters, Alexander honey strainer, Root's automatic extractor, Baines capping melter, wax extractors and presses, queen-rearing outfits, 'Porter" escapes, Van Deusen wax-tube fastener, honey bags and cartons, bee veils, bee brushes, books on beekeeping. Quantity: 1 album(s). Physical Description: Booklet of 32 pages, each 215 x 142 mm.

Alliance Box Company Limited :Alliance beehives and bee-keepers supplies. Season 1917-1...
Date: 1917
By: Alliance Box Company Ltd; Stone, Son and Company
Reference: Eph-A-BEE-SUPPLIES-1917-01
Description: Lists and illustrates items for sale, with prices. Merchandise includes: Alliance twelve-frame dove-tailed hives, Hoffman frames, section frames, metal spaced frames, nickelled steel hive tool, comb foundation, Baines capping reducer, honey extractors, Hershiser wax press, Root wax press and uncapping can, Solar wax extractors, Swiss wax extractor, Benton queen cage, Alley queen and drone trap, honey knives, Porter bee escape, spur wire embedder, golden and three-banded queens, Holterman bee brushes, bee veils, smokers, honey packages, west cell protectors, Miller queen-catcher and introducing cage. Quantity: 1 album(s). Physical Description: Letterpress, in booklet of 16 pages, each 213 x 139 mm.
